Introduction: In recent years, the field of robotics has made significant advancements in various industries, including healthcare. One area where robotics has proved to be particularly beneficial is pediatric services. The use of robotic technologies in the medical world has paved the way for innovative approaches to diagnosis, treatment, and care for children. In this blog post, we will explore how robotics is revolutionizing pediatric services, providing efficient, precise, and compassionate care for our young patients. 1. Enhanced Surgical Procedures: One of the most significant contributions of robotics in pediatric services is in the field of surgery. Robotic-assisted surgery allows surgeons to perform complex procedures with enhanced precision, control, and access to hard-to-reach areas. This technology minimizes invasiveness, reduces scarring, and results in faster recovery times. When it comes to pediatric surgery, where smaller incisions and delicate procedures are often required, robotics has become an invaluable tool for surgeons, ensuring optimal outcomes and improved patient safety. 2. Remote Monitoring and Telemedicine: Access to healthcare is a crucial aspect of pediatric medicine, especially for children living in remote areas or those with chronic conditions. Robotic technologies enable remote monitoring and telemedicine, facilitating increased access to specialized pediatric care. By employing telepresence robots, doctors can virtually interact with patients and their families, examine medical records, offer consultations, and even monitor vital signs in real-time. This technology not only saves time and travel costs for families but also ensures that children receive timely medical attention regardless of their geographical location. 3. Rehabilitation and Physical Therapy: Robotics has opened new horizons for pediatric rehabilitation and physical therapy. With the use of robotic exoskeletons and assistive devices, children with physical disabilities can regain mobility, improve their motor skills, and enhance their quality of life. These advanced technologies provide personalized therapy plans, tailored to the specific needs of each child, promoting better engagement and motivation throughout the rehabilitation process. Robot-assisted physical therapy not only makes the experience interactive and enjoyable for children but also allows therapists to track progress and adjust treatment plans accordingly. 4. Emotional Support and Social Interaction: Hospital stays and medical procedures can be distressing for children, often leading to increased anxiety and fear. Robotics plays a crucial role in providing emotional support and facilitating social interaction for young patients. Robotic companions, such as cuddly animal-like robots, can offer comfort and companionship, distracting children during medical procedures and reducing their anxiety. Additionally, interactive robotic toys can serve as playmates, supporting children's cognitive and social development, and making their hospital experience more enjoyable. Conclusion: The integration of robotics in pediatric services has transformed the way healthcare is delivered to children. From improving surgical outcomes to facilitating remote consultations, enhancing rehabilitation, and providing emotional support, robotics has revolutionized pediatric care. As technology continues to advance, we can expect even more innovative applications in the field, ensuring a brighter and healthier future for our young patients. By harnessing the power of robotics, healthcare providers are embracing a new era of efficient, effective, and compassionate care, ultimately improving the quality of life for children and their families.
